Post by Pugsy » Wed Jan 03, 2018 6:45 am

Looks like you have the DreamStation AVAPS model 1130 and it may not be compatible as I think it was also released after this last version of SleepyHead.
Check version upper left corner of SleepyHead when open....latest is 1.0.0 Beta 2

The regular BiPap DreamStation...the Pro and the Auto SleepyHead with work with but not the high end specialty machines.
You most likely will need Encore Pro. Windows only software.
